My Sabbatical



I was diagnosed with Parkinson’s Disease nearly two years ago and I am still generally healthy. However, it is a degenerative disease and my condition will inevitably deteriorate.  While I am still well I would like to do more travelling and other activities – including more exercise to ensure I remain healthy for as long as possible.

With this in mind, I am considering going part-time.

In order to explore this, I am planning to take a three month “sabbatical” after Easter.  Mark will take on a full-time role and I will work part-time for the period to see how this goes.  We are working out the arrangements together.
